ROME - Scientists say they have made a huge breakthrough in their search for a treatment for the coronavirus , in the form of cannabis. Scientists at the University of Lethbridge say they have found potent strains of cannabis that could help prevent and then treat COVID-19. According to the researchers, cannabis can reduce the virus's entry points into the body by up to 70%. Speaking to CTV News, Olga Kovalchuk, one of the researchers, said: " At first we were totally amazed and then we were really happy ." The researchers acknowledge that more research is needed, but say cannabis
could be used to develop preventive treatments "in the form of mouthwashes and throat gargles. Given the current disastrous and rapidly evolving epidemiological situation, it is necessary to consider every possible therapeutic opportunity and so on".
